Swagger annotations library support

Change-Id: Ib2843e541580c4accca2a6411449f77a7ea7a02b
diff --git a/lib/BUCK b/lib/BUCK
index 8b6dc1d..5436710 100644
--- a/lib/BUCK
+++ b/lib/BUCK
@@ -1519,3 +1519,11 @@
   visibility = [ 'PUBLIC' ],
 )
 
+remote_jar (
+  name = 'swagger-annotations',
+  out = 'swagger-annotations-1.5.16.jar',
+  url = 'mvn:io.swagger:swagger-annotations:jar:1.5.16',
+  sha1 = '935f1f2fed2cbdd7a0513981d6c53201e21155f4',
+  maven_coords = 'io.swagger:swagger-annotations:1.5.16',
+  visibility = [ 'PUBLIC' ],
+)
\ No newline at end of file
diff --git a/lib/deps.json b/lib/deps.json
index 071d95f..f0f796c 100644
--- a/lib/deps.json
+++ b/lib/deps.json
@@ -270,6 +270,7 @@
     "google-instrumentation-0.3.0": "mvn:com.google.instrumentation:instrumentation-api:0.3.0",
     "bcpkix-jdk15on": "mvn:org.bouncycastle:bcpkix-jdk15on:1.58",
     "bcprov-jdk15on": "mvn:org.bouncycastle:bcprov-jdk15on:1.58",
-    "hamcrest-optional": "mvn:com.spotify:hamcrest-optional:1.1.0"
+    "hamcrest-optional": "mvn:com.spotify:hamcrest-optional:1.1.0",
+    "swagger-annotations": "mvn:io.swagger:swagger-annotations:1.5.16"
   }
 }